Ursula Stanhope

Ursula is portrayed as adventurous and curious, always eager to explore new terrains and embrace the unknown. As she navigates her relationships, her empathy and compassion emerge, particularly towards George. Her character development reflects the struggle between societal expectations and following one's heart.

George

George is the epitome of innocence and bravery, embodying the spirit of the jungle as its protector. His clumsiness is juxtaposed with moments of heroism, particularly in his relationships with Ursula and his animal friends. George's growth throughout the film highlights themes of love, adventure, and resilience.

Lyle van de Groot

Lyle is depicted as a cowardly character whose selfish motives put Ursula in danger. His character serves as a foil to George, contrasting bravery with insecurity. Despite his comical attempts to reclaim Ursula, Lyle ultimately embodies the typical antagonist role, reminding audiences of the importance of courage.

❤️ Love

The theme of love is central as Ursula navigates her feelings between George and Lyle. Ursula's growing affection for George emphasizes the importance of true connection and acceptance. Their love story showcases how genuine relationships can flourish in the most unexpected surroundings.

🌱 Adventure

Adventure pervades the film as characters embark on a journey through the wild jungles of Burundi. The quest to rescue Ape and confront threats highlights the spirit of exploration and discovery. As George traverses both the jungle and city, he embodies the essence of adventure, embracing challenges head-on.

🐒 Friendship

Friendship is celebrated through George's bond with his animal companions, such as Ape and Shep. Their camaraderie provides support and loyalty amidst chaotic situations. The interactions between characters signify the joys of companionship, reminding audiences that friends can come from the most unlikely places.
